Step into Peggy’s World

In the heart of rural Iowa during 1941, Scattergood immerses readers in the life of twelve-year-old Peggy, whose once quiet existence is transformed by the arrival of refugees and the pains of first love. The reopening of a Quaker hostel to shelter Jewish refugees introduces new individuals who challenge Peggy's newly emerging feelings and understanding of the world around her.

A Tug on the Heartstrings

Peggy’s life takes a dramatic turn when she discovers that her beloved cousin, Delia, is battling leukemia, unaware of her condition. This revelation sends Peggy on an emotional rollercoaster, as she attempts to hold onto the rationality she has always relied upon. However, the stark reality of Delia's situation begins to unravel her sense of control, leading her to seek a remedy that may not exist.

Complex Characters and Raw Emotions

As Peggy interacts with the new refugees, including the mysterious Gunther, she begins to feel the weight of her emotions press heavily upon her. The connection she craves with Gunther seems just out of reach, and she feels the sting of being misunderstood by those around her. Meanwhile, the troubled professor she befriends becomes another puzzle as Peggy tries to assist him in locating his missing daughter.

A Learning Experience

Scattergood masterfully portrays the tumultuous journey of a girl facing her vulnerabilities head-on while dealing with the complexities of life's randomness. This historical novel provides not only a glimpse into Peggy's inner struggles but also into the broader context of World War II, moving away from the battlefields and focusing on personal stories of resilience. H.M. Bouwman captures the essence of growing up in a world that feels far from stable yet beautifully complex.

Discover This Powerful Story

Perfect for young adults and anyone who appreciates a deep dive into character development against a historical backdrop, Scattergood serves as a reminder that even in the face of uncertainty, growth is possible. This engaging read is a Junior Library Guild Gold Standard Selection, appealing to a wide range of audiences.
